BREAD OF LIFE CHURCH TO HOST CONCERT BY HEAVENLY HARP Bread of Life Lutheran Church will host a concert by Heavenly Harp, a mother-daughter duo, from Phoenix, Ariz., Aug. 27 at 7 p.m. in the church at 1415-17th Ave. SW.

Karin and Joy Gunderson will share their ministry via harp, flute and vocal music. The "Summer Serenity" concert will include classical pieces, favorite hymns and inspiring stories.

The event is free, but a freewill offering will be received.

HARVEST REFORMED CHURCH SERVICES TO BE HELD IN NEW LOCATION Harvest Reformed Church has changed the location for its worship services.

Worship services will now be held Sundays at 10:30 a.m. in the Norse Room of the Grand International Hotel, 1505 N. Broadway.

CHRIST LUTHERAN ADDING SATURDAY WORSHIP TO SCHEDULE Christ Lutheran Church, of Minot, has added a Saturday service to its worship schedule. The worship schedule will be Saturday at 5 p.m. and Sunday at 9 a.m., effective today.

Starting Sept. 11, worship services will be at 5 p.m. Saturday at 9:30 a.m. Sunday.

All services for Christ Lutheran Church, which was damaged during the flood, will continue to be held in Bethany Lutheran Church, 215-3rd Ave. SE, until further notice.
